The care I get from Eastview seems pretty good. Vets are generally friendly and knowledgeable. Girls up front are good as well but the vet charges are high. Just had the pooch examined and it was detemined she had a ear infection which is why I bought her in the clinic to begin with. The charge for a 30 sec look in the ear was $47, $35 for an injection, $32 for some antibotics, and $16.50 for an ear spray. Grand total was $130.50! But what can you do? Are all vets this high these days? Maybe it is time to check around. With the prices Satisfactory is the best I can do on their rating. (on a final note this is higher than a visit to my doctor even before my deductible is met!)
